Description
Introductory lecture linking crystalline structure to industrial reliability: bonding and lattices, grains and defects, slip and deformation, phase diagrams and heat treatment, corrosion, creep, fatigue, wear, welding effects, NDE, and case studies. Emphasis on microstructure control, specification, processing windows, and inspection planning to prevent failures and extend equipment life.
